Persons between the ages of 18 and 21 years in lawful possession of a firearm are not prohibited from carrying an unconcealed firearm (?open carry?) without a provisional license as long as the person obeys all other applicable laws and restrictions.
West Virginia has no waiting period requirement for the purchase of a firearm. It is illegal for the following people to possess a firearm in West Virginia: People who have been convicted in any court of a crime punishable by imprisonment for a term exceeding one year. People who are habitually addicted to alcohol.
No state permit is required to purchase a rifle, shotgun or handgun. Private firearm transfers are not subject to a background check in West Virginia, although state and federal purchase prohibitions still apply. No state permit is required to possess a rifle, shotgun or handgun.
Do Guns Have to Be Registered in West Virginia? Is There a Waiting Period to Buy a Gun in West Virginia? No. There is no firearms registration requirement in West Virginia.
Q: Is a license required to carry a concealed handgun in West Virginia? A: No, CHLs are optional, so long as the person is at least 21 years of age or older, is not prohibited from possessing a firearm, and is a United States citizen or legal resident thereof.
(A) ? Except as provided in this section, no person shall possess a firearm who: (1) Has been convicted in any court of a crime punishable by imprisonment for a term exceeding one year. (2) Is an unlawful user of or habitually addicted to any controlled substance, including alcohol.
